Help Improve the Health of Minority Populations
National Minority Health Month is a time to reemphasize the importance of health care in racial and ethnic minority communities. Health disparities disproportionately affect people from historically marginalized communities, who often face greater health care challenges, including:
- - Limited access to care
- - Higher rates of chronic conditions
- - Worse health outcomes
- - Stigma and discrimination in health care settings
